PROUD SPONSOR OF DOORS & WINDOWS DOORS&WINDOWS Growth leads to £700,000 logistics investment » » CAMDEN’S CONTINUED GROWTH has led to investment in its logistic department, with the £700,000 purchase of seven new Volvo lorries. The new additions to the fleet allow for greater loads to be carried as they have extra horsepower, whilst maintaining their eco-friendly credentials with twin fuel tanks, side skirts and roof deflectors. This recent commitment brings the Camden Group’s fleet up to 20 lorries, with plans to invest more over in the future. However high spec lorries are not solely about saving money, they also are good for Camden’s team of drivers. Seamus Lavery, spokesperson at Camden said: “This is a significant expenditure for Camden, but it makes good economic sense. We expect a good return on investment through the savings we will be able to make on fuel costs, as the new lorries are fitted with a ‘long haul fuel package’.” The new Volvo vehicles are now on the road delivering windows and doors around the UK and are also bringing back old window frames to Camden’s on-site recycling plant, ready to be made into new products. VEKA Group uses only the highest quality raw materials and components for its industry- leading PVC-U profile systems, and the company is proud to celebrate the suppliers that go above and beyond in both product and service. VEKA Group’s Purchasing Manager Nicola Woods said: “The selection process to become a VEKA Group supplier is rigorous, and then these carefully chosen partners undergo continuous, stringent monitoring to ensure our standards are upheld. “Key suppliers are provided with a monthly ‘vendor rating report’ which outlines how we have judged their performance. They are graded on quantitative data such as number of non-conformances and ‘on time in full’ deliveries, but also on qualitative data such as customer service, flexibility and timely responses to queries. “This means we can closely monitor our supply chain, and continue to provide the best possible customer experience. Quite a few visitors bring architects drawings with them; on the hunt for great design and technical features with high levels of security, which would provide them with a grand entrance. Very few consumers are put off by a £5-8k price tag and many expect the S-500 Series doors to retail for twice as much. Spitfire Doors is recognised as a true luxury brand, with each door combining premium quality Schueco aluminium profiles with engineering excellence. The S-500 Series specifically offers a very high level of certifiable security, having passed level RC3, at IFT Rosenheim in Germany and PAS24 at BSI in the UK. This, coupled with exceptional thermal performance (U-Values as low as 0.7 W/m2K), and the opportunity to design your own door, really does offer homeowners to create their own perfect entrance. www.spitfiredoors.co.uk
